The cost of a hotel room during Lacy’s trip is $325. The hotel room tax in the city she is in is 10.5%. What is the total cost of the hotel room?

Answer:

$359.13

Explanation:

To find the total cost of her room we have to add the cost of the tax to the cost of the room.

To find the value of the tax, multiply the value of the room(325) by 10.5%:

Convert 10.5% to decimal form: 0.105

0.105 * 325 = 34.125

34.125 rounds up to 34.13.

Now, add the cost of the tax to the room's cost:

34.13 + 325 = 359.13

The total cost of the hotel room is $359.13.
